SPECIES: Bornean Orangutans

 

pongo pygmaeus wurmbii

 

This subspecies is more commonly known as the central bornean orangutan.

 

The central bornean orangutan is the largest of the three subspecies of bornean orangutan and can only be found in Central Kalimantan, Indonesia on the island of Borneo.

 

It is believed that there are less than 40,000 individuals remaining in the wild.
